Description:
Amazon Web Services (AWS) seeks a Senior Finance Manager to be a key member of AWS Marketing Finance team. This is an exciting opportunity to join one of the fastest growing divisions within Amazon.

This role will help drive growth of AWS business by providing strategic guidance and analytical insights to senior leaders using various investment frameworks and measurement techniques. It will oversee the financial planning, reporting, and month end close for AWS Field Marketing. Additionally, it will effectively partner with Accounting, Tax, Economists, Data Science and other Finance teams to report and evaluate impact of marketing investments on financial results, sales pipeline and AWS brand perception. The role will manage an international team and strategically partner with senior business leaders across Europe and Asia to provide financial intelligence for key decisions and assist with evaluating business opportunities, measuring outcomes from investments and developing long term plans.

Key responsibilities:
• Lead a team of Finance Managers and Senior Financial Analysts across Europe and Asia.
• Create and implement performance metrics to measure effectiveness of marketing investments
• Develop financial insights in support of marketing investment decisions
• Drive planning and forecasting processes

The successful candidate will have shown experiences in past roles influencing senior business leaders and supporting decision-making in rapidly evolving environments. This role requires a self-starter with strong modeling skills, a keen attention to detail, and ability to manage multiple projects effectively. This role also has regular interaction with business executives across Amazon, therefore requires strong interpersonal and communication skills.
